A suspected gang assault on a pool corridor in Ecuador in a single day left seven useless and 4 wounded, police mentioned Saturday. It marked the second such assault in lower than a month in the identical metropolis throughout a wave of violence within the nation.

Movies posted on social media confirmed gunmen, most of them masked, opening hearth as folks performed billiards within the metropolis of Santo Domingo, about 100 miles west of Quito.

“Presumably this violent incident stems from a territorial dispute between organized crime teams and arranged armed teams,” police Colonel Beatriz Benavides mentioned.

Ecuador is some extent of departure for cocaine shipments to the USA and Europe, and a hub for felony teams concerned in extortion and contract killings — a few of them linked to cartels based mostly in Mexico, Colombia or Albania.

The late Friday assault was the fourth of its type in latest weeks. In August, seven folks had been killed in a pool corridor in the identical metropolis. A related pool corridor bloodbath passed off in July within the southwestern vacationer metropolis of Basic Villamil Playas, leaving not less than 9 useless. 

In April, armed males killed 12 folks at a cockfighting ring 18 miles from Santo Domingo.

Ecuador recorded greater than 4,600 homicides within the first half of the 12 months, a 47% enhance from the identical interval of 2024, knowledge from the Ecuadoran Observatory of Organized Crime exhibits.

Felony gang violence continues unabated following the recapture in June of the nation’s largest drug lord, Adolfo Macías, alias Fito, after he escaped from a maximum-security jail in 2024.

In July, the Ecuadoran authorities extradited Macías to the USA, and he pleaded not responsible. A seven-count indictment prices Macías, who leads the gang Los Choneros, and an unidentified co-defendant with worldwide cocaine distribution, conspiracy and weapons counts, together with smuggling firearms from the U.S.

Final 12 months, the U.S. labeled Los Choneros as probably the most violent gangs and affirmed its connection to highly effective Mexican drug cartels, which threaten Ecuador and the encircling area
